Solomobi Cool8800C Phone

Solomobi has come up with its latest handset – the Cool8800C. This phone is weirdly named, and hailing from China, you can’t really expect it to shine in terms of software although the hardware segment of things have improved over the years compared to the first generation of China-originated handsets. Dual SIM cards are supported, while an analog TV tuner allows you to use this in Third World countries as you travel, checking out what’s going on with the local TV channels. The flip out display and keypad is the outstanding feature here, as doing so will reveal a larger display underneath alongside dedicated gaming controls. Unfortunately, there are only three pre-loaded classic NES titles on this, so you’ll need to load ROMs yourself via a memory card. Would you fork out $140 for the Cool8800C? We’d rather get a new DS Lite instead and stick to an old phone model.
